how do you know if your 7-week old chi has an ear infection?  I daughter bathed her and now she has really puffy eyes, shakes her head alot (not while playing) and has really pink paws.  Im afraid she got water in her ears.

Odds are, your daughter got water and/or soap in the dogs ears and eyes.  When bathing practically any dog, wash the body and neck and rinse normally.  Put a little bit of lather on a washcloth and gently clean the face (pretend it's a human baby).  Then rinse the cloth out and wipe again.  Don't pour water over their heads.  Chihuahuas especially are very fastidious and will clean their faces just as a cat does, by licking a paw and running it over their face and head.

In future, put some cotton in the dogs ears to keep the water out and follow the directions above.  Unless they've rolled in something stinky, chihuahuas don't need to be bathed more than once every month or two.  The only thing that smells on a healthy chihuahua is their feet, since that is the only place they have sweat glands.  It's easy to wash them with a soapy rag and rinse well.  They should also have their teeth brushed at least once a week.  I use a baby toothbrush and paste (non-foaming and ok to swallow), don't use your grownup toothpaste.  If you start young, they grow to accept it, and be sure to give them a treat after and praise them during and after for not squirming, that way they associate toothbrushing with treats and happy humans.

Now, as to what to do.  Take precious puppy to the vet!  NOW!  Take along whatever was used to bathe the dog.  It sounds like she might be having a reaction to the soap/shampoo, especially if she is licking her paw pads or scratching them by pawing at the carpet.  FYI, an ear infection will usually give the ears a 'funky' smell.
